ホームページ >バックエンド開発 >PHPチュートリアル >PHPは開始日と終了日の間のすべての日付を取得します
プロジェクトの要件により、指定された日付範囲内のデータを取得し、それを毎日処理する必要があります。
例えば、2016-06-01から2016-06-05までの日付範囲の毎日のデータを処理する必要があります。まず、この日付範囲内の毎日の日付を取得し、ループで処理を実行する必要があります。
<code><span><span><?php</span><span>$date</span> = <span>array</span>(<span>'2016-06-01'</span>,<span>'2016-06-02'</span>,<span>'2016-06-03'</span>,<span>'2016-06-04'</span>,<span>'2016-06-05'</span>); <span>foreach</span>(<span>$date</span><span>as</span><span>$d</span>){ <span>// 执行处理</span> } <span>?></span></span></code>
日付範囲が長い期間 (2015-09-01 から 2016-06-30) にまたがり、年や月 (閏月) にまたがる状況がある場合、日付配列を手動で作成するのは時間がかかりすぎます。そして理不尽。
そこで、指定された日付範囲内の毎日の日付を取得する次のメソッドを作成しました。コードは次のとおりです。 ; $(this).addClass('has-numbering').parent().append($numbering); for (i = 1; i
').text(i)); }; $numbering.fadeIn(1700); }); });上記は、開始日と終了日の間のすべての日付を取得するための php を内容も含めて紹介しました。PHP チュートリアルに興味のある友人に役立つことを願っています。